Southwest Onslow is on a five-game streak of home wins, while East Duplin is on a three-game streak of away wins: one of those streaks is about to end. Southwest Onslow will welcome East Duplin at 6:00 p.m. on Friday. Southwest Onslow is strutting in with some offensive muscle as they've averaged 3.2 goals per game this season.
Southwest Onslow's defense heads into the contest hoping to repeat the dominance they displayed on Tuesday. They walked away with a 2-0 win over Wallace-Rose Hill. Give Southwest Onslow's defense some credit: that's the team's fifth straight shutout.
Jaime Maguire and Haley Smith scored both of Southwest Onslow's goals, bringing their combined season tally to six goals.
Meanwhile, East Duplin unfortunately witnessed the end of their three-game winning streak on Wednesday. They fell just short of White Oak by a score of 2-1.
Southwest Onslow's victory bumped their record up to 8-1-1. As for East Duplin, they now have a losing record of 5-6-2.
Southwest Onslow might still be hurting after the 5-1 loss they got from East Duplin in their previous matchup back in May of 2024. That match was all but decided by halftime, at which point Southwest Onslow was down 4-0.
